What a great discussion!  Because my son is a SW, I have frankly never thought about that "fine line" between the two..  I know he is SW because he had the classic crisis at 10 days of age.  Quite scary.  I did want to add a point about what I have "read" from parents and what my doc has done re: dosing.  There have been times that it seemed a need to increase cortef dose, but the doc was concerned about growth.  So, we we upped the florinef a bit and have had good results.  I have heard the same done with SV.

My son is 7 and we have not had any weight problems, sensitivity to heat, problems participating in sports.  He is quite slim, but good muscle tone.  Is very active in soccer, swimming, and baseball.  Especially soccer.  Even is 95*  August heat in the south at soccer camp, I have never noticed the need to hydrate more than other kids.  He does like salty foods, but I do not salt his food any more than the rest of the family.
